BLACKBURN, Judge.

This discretionary appeal is from the trial court's order affirming the decision of the Richmond County Board of Commissioners revoking appellant S. J. T., Inc.'s (S. J. T.) license to sell alcohol at a night club and bar which it owns and operates, known as T J Smiles. T J Smiles is located in the unincorporated part of Richmond County, Georgia, and provides nude dancing.
